MARKETPLACE ROUND-UP

          DEALS: Time Warner and Daimler-Chrysler's Dodge
     division inked a one-year, $15M "cross-media ad deal," which
     includes print ads in SI, ads on CNN/SI.com and TV ads on
     CNN, CNN/SI and the CNN Airport Network (AD AGE, 1/18
     issue)....Golfer Patty Sheehan, on losing four sponsors,
     including Callaway: "I figured my contract would be cut [due
     to an industry downturn], but I didn't figure I would be
     cut.  It was very disappointing.  Obviously, what I've done,
     having Hall of Fame status, didn't matter" (ST. PETE TIMES,
     1/21)....MA-based Veryfine juices has become an official
     sponsor of NAPBL for the '99 season.  The company will
     implement a promotional program in 150 Minor League
     ballparks and receive the opportunity to sell its beverages
     at many of the venues (Veryfine)....NC Speedway in
     Rockingham signed a "multiyear deal" with Dura-Lube and
     Kmart, which will present the Winston Cup Dura-Lube/Big K
     400 in February (CHARLOTTE OBSERVER, 1/19)....AJ Foyt
     Enterprises signed with Pennzoil and the motor oil's logo
     will be highlighted on Foyt-backed cars, including those of
     Billy Boat and Kenny Brack during this weekend's IRL Indy
     200 in Orlando (SPEEDNET, 1/20)....Fruit of the Loom and its
     Pro Player brand have signed an exclusive licensing deal to
     manufacture apparel for Planet Hollywood and the Official
     All Star Cafe (Pro Player)....Toyota inked a two-year deal
     to become the co-title sponsor of the Schwinn Toyota Bicycle
     Stunt Team and has also renewed its co-title sponsorship of
     the Schwinn Toyota RAV4 Mountain Bike Team (Toyota)....The
     Braves and TBS will be an associate sponsor on Jerry
     Nadeau's Ford on the Winston Cup circuit (TENNESSEAN, 1/17).
          BAY WATCH: "Armageddon" Dir Michael Bay is now
     directing a new series of Nike TV ads: "I get itchy to shoot
     again.  These commercials help calm me down" (EW, 1/22).
